Sample Answer
Absolutely, traditional events and festivals maintain significant relevance in contemporary society. They serve not merely as cultural touchstones but also act as a repository for shared history and communal identity. In an age characterized by rapid globalization and cultural homogenization, these events provide a vital counter-narrative, fostering a sense of belonging and continuity among individuals. Moreover, they stimulate local economies and promote tourism, thus serving as a catalyst for social cohesion and economic vitality. For instance, festivals often bring together diverse groups, allowing for intercultural dialogue and the exchange of ideas. In essence, while modernity may influence the way these traditions are celebrated, their underlying significance in promoting community spirit and cultural heritage remains undiminished.
